Ponnam Prabhakar Strongly Condemns Party Change 

Hyderabad, July 26 (Maxim News):  Senior Congress leader and former MP, Ponnam Prabhakar, strongly condemned and alleged that his political opponents in the party are conspiring and spreading bad propaganda that he is changing the party.

In a statement issued today, said that as per the Sonia Gandhi and Rahul Gandhi instructions, the Congress party leaders will work hard to bring the party back to power in the Telangana state as well as at the Center under the leadership of AICC President Mallikarjuna Kharge.  He said that as an active worker of the Congress party, he along with his supporters will participate in the meeting at Kolhapur to be held on July 30. which will be addressed by Priyanka Gandhi.  (Maxim News)
